首页技术parsevideo视频解析?视频解析video

parsevideo视频解析?视频解析video

编程之家2026-06-24854次浏览

这篇文章给大家聊聊关于parsevideo视频解析,以及视频解析video对应的知识点,希望对各位有所帮助,不要忘了收藏本站哦。

parsevideo视频解析?视频解析video

【API接口】全网聚合短视频解析

全网聚合短视频解析API接口介绍

专为开发者打造的高性能、可扩展的短视频解析聚合接口,能够无缝接入抖音、快手、小红书、微视、皮皮虾、皮皮搞笑、好看视频、新片场、配音秀、梨视频、今日头条、开眼、陌陌、比心共十四个平台的视频解析能力。以下是对该API接口的详细介绍:

一、接口概述

该API接口旨在帮助开发者简化短视频解析流程,告别繁琐的逆向工程与平台规则适配,从而专注于核心业务逻辑。通过该接口,开发者可以轻松获取各大短视频平台的视频标题、视频封面以及无水印视频地址等信息。

二、使用前准备

注册并获取API Key:

parsevideo视频解析?视频解析video

开发者需要先前往注册地址进行注册,并获取专属的API Key。

了解接口地址:

接口地址为:

三、请求方式及参数

请求方式:支持GET和POST两种方式。请求参数:apikey:开发者在注册后获取的API Key,用于验证请求的有效性。

url:待解析的短视频链接,必须为上述十四个平台中的有效链接。

parsevideo视频解析?视频解析video

四、返回格式

返回格式为application/json,即JSON格式的数据。五、请求示例

GET请求示例:你开通的apikey&url=短视频链接六、返回参数说明

work_title:视频标题,即短视频的标题信息。work_cover:视频封面,即短视频的封面图片链接。work_url:视频/图集无水印地址,即短视频的无水印播放地址或图集链接。七、注意事项

API Key保护:请妥善保管您的API Key,避免泄露给未经授权的第三方。请求频率限制:为了保障服务质量,接口对请求频率有一定的限制,请开发者合理控制请求次数。数据准确性:由于短视频平台的内容更新频繁,接口返回的数据可能存在一定的延迟或误差,请开发者在使用时自行验证数据的准确性。合规使用:请确保您的使用行为符合相关法律法规及平台规定,避免用于非法用途。八、示例图片

(注:以上图片为示例图片,展示了接口可能返回的部分数据内容。)

综上所述,全网聚合短视频解析API接口为开发者提供了便捷、高效的短视频解析服务,能够帮助开发者快速获取各大短视频平台的视频信息。在使用该接口时,请务必遵守相关规定,确保合规使用。

Taro小程序富文本解析4种方法

Taro小程序富文本解析4种方法

在Taro小程序开发中,富文本解析是一个常见的需求。以下是四种常用的富文本解析方法,每种方法都有其独特的优点和缺点。

1. Taro组件rich-text

优点:使用极其方便,只需简单引用即可。

缺点:不支持视频内容,这在需要展示多媒体内容的场景中是一个较大的限制。

2. wxParse

GitHub地址:

过程:

wxParse是一个功能强大的富文本解析库,支持HTML到小程序的转换。

优点:

支持样式和视频内容,能够满足多样化的展示需求。

缺点:

页面加载时,图片会有由大变正常的过渡效果,这可能会影响用户体验。

3. taro-parse

示例:

taro-parse是专为Taro小程序设计的富文本解析库。

优点:

使用方便,配置简单,支持视频内容。

缺点:

不支持样式,这在需要自定义文本样式的场景中可能会受到限制。

4. Parser

下载:

文档:Parser插件文档(具体链接需根据官方提供查找)

使用方法:

Parser是一个功能全面且灵活的富文本解析库。

优点:

支持样式和视频内容,能够满足复杂的展示需求。

提供了丰富的配置选项,可以根据实际需求进行定制。

缺点:

不支持wav格式的视频,但可以通过修改代码中的相关语句来解决这个问题。具体方法是,将需要解析为视频的标签改成video,需要解析成音频的改成audio。

在选择Taro小程序的富文本解析方法时,需要根据具体需求进行权衡。如果只需要简单的文本展示,Taro组件rich-text可能是一个不错的选择。如果需要支持视频和样式,wxParse和Parser都是不错的选择,但需要注意wxParse的图片加载效果问题以及Parser对wav视频的支持问题。如果希望有一个使用方便且配置简单的解决方案,taro-parse可能是一个不错的选择,但需要注意它不支持样式。最终选择哪种方法,需要根据项目的具体需求和开发者的偏好来决定。

java爬虫找图片视频教程

以下是使用Java爬虫提取图片和视频的详细教程,结合Jsoup库实现基础功能,并补充关键注意事项和扩展方案:

一、基础实现步骤环境配置

在Maven项目的pom.xml中添加Jsoup依赖:<dependency><groupId>org.jsoup</groupId><artifactId>jsoup</artifactId><version>1.15.3</version></dependency>

如需处理视频,建议额外添加Apache HttpClient:<dependency><groupId>org.apache.httpcomponents</groupId><artifactId>httpclient</artifactId><version>4.5.13</version></dependency>

核心代码实现

图片下载示例:

import org.jsoup.Jsoup;import org.jsoup.nodes.Document;import org.jsoup.nodes.Element;import java.io.IOException;import java.io.InputStream;import java.nio.file.Files;import java.nio.file.Paths;import java.net.URL;public class MediaDownloader{ public static void downloadImages(String webpageUrl, String savePath) throws IOException{ Document doc= Jsoup.connect(webpageUrl).get(); for(Element img: doc.select("img[src]")){ String imgUrl= img.absUrl("src"); try(InputStream in= new URL(imgUrl).openStream()){ String filename= Paths.get(imgUrl).getFileName().toString(); Files.copy(in, Paths.get(savePath, filename));}}}}

视频下载方案(需根据实际网站调整):

//示例:处理HTML5 video标签for(Element video: doc.select("video source[src]")){ String videoUrl= video.absUrl("src");//使用HttpClient处理大文件更稳定 CloseableHttpClient client= HttpClients.createDefault(); HttpGet request= new HttpGet(videoUrl); try(CloseableHttpResponse response= client.execute(request)){ Files.copy(response.getEntity().getContent(), Paths.get(savePath,"video.mp4"));}}

二、关键注意事项合法性验证

检查目标网站的robots.txt文件(如)

遵守《著作权法》及网站服务条款,避免爬取受保护内容

反爬机制应对

设置User-Agent模拟浏览器:Document doc= Jsoup.connect(url).userAgent("Mozilla/5.0").timeout(10000).get();

对频繁请求添加延迟:Thread.sleep(2000);// 2秒间隔

异常处理

try{//爬取逻辑} catch(IOException e){ System.err.println("网络请求失败:"+ e.getMessage());} catch(IllegalArgumentException e){ System.err.println("URL解析错误:"+ e.getMessage());}三、进阶优化方案多线程下载

ExecutorService executor= Executors.newFixedThreadPool(5);doc.select("img[src]").forEach(img->{ executor.submit(()-> downloadImage(img.absUrl("src")));});executor.shutdown();动态内容处理

对于JavaScript渲染的页面,需结合Selenium:WebDriver driver= new ChromeDriver();driver.get(url);String html= driver.getPageSource();Document doc= Jsoup.parse(html);

断点续传

Path filePath= Paths.get(savePath, filename);if(Files.exists(filePath)){ long existingSize= Files.size(filePath);//设置Range头实现断点续传 HttpGet request= new HttpGet(mediaUrl); request.setHeader("Range","bytes="+ existingSize+"-");}四、完整示例项目结构src/├── main/│├── java/││└── MediaCrawler.java(主程序)│└── resources/│└── config.properties(配置文件)└── test/└── java/└── CrawlerTest.java(测试类)五、学习资源推荐官方文档

Jsoup Cookbook

Apache HttpClient教程

实践建议

先从静态网站(如维基百科页面)开始练习

使用Fiddler/Wireshark分析实际网络请求

定期检查目标网站结构变化

本方案覆盖了从基础实现到生产环境部署的关键要点,实际开发中需根据具体网站的反爬策略和数据格式进行调整。建议先在小规模数据上测试,再逐步扩展功能。

关于parsevideo视频解析的内容到此结束,希望对大家有所帮助。

airpods pro2连接安卓手机 AirPods Pro怎么连接安卓手机目前ai智能软件排名 ai工具排名2025 国内ai人工智能软件前十名汇总